Heritage Park is officially getting into the Christmas spirit, as Saturday, November 23 marks the first day of their Once Upon a Christmas event.

The event will feature wagon rides, Christmas carols, and a visit by Mr. Claus himself at the historical village, and attendees will be able to learn what Christmas was like back in the day as many of the homes and buildings open their doors to the public.

New to the event for 2019 is a 1950s Storybook Christmas experience, with classic stories, interactive crafts, and visits from holiday characters from the 1950s and 1960s.

Shopping will be available at the gift shops at the front gates, hot drinks and snacks can be found at the Railway Cafe, Wainwright Hotel Bar Room, and the Club Cafe (because that hot chocolate is a definite necessity), and a Christmas breakfast buffet will be served each morning for an additional cost.

Admittance to the event will run adults $11, though discounts are available for children, youth, and seniors.

The Once Upon a Christmas event will be held at Heritage Park every Saturday and Sunday from November 23 to December 22, and tickets can be purchased online at Heritage Park’s website or at the gate.
